Composite MIL-DTL-38999 connectors now available with 48-hour assembly service

PEI-Genesis, the franchised assembler and distributor of electronic connectors, has expanded its portfolio of Amphenol products to include the CTV series of composite circular connectors, which feature a lightweight design that makes them particularly suitable for use in aerospace applications.

Available from PEI-Genesis with an unrivalled 48-hour assembly service, the CTV series can be supplied as either proprietary parts or as fully qualified MIL-DTL-38999 Series III connectors with a choice of olive drab or electroless nickel plating.

The composite material used for the CTV shells are said to enable the connectors to achieve weight savings of 17-40 per cent compared with standard aluminium parts and up to 70 per cent compared with stainless steel versions. In addition, the CTV connectors claim high-corrosion resistance, providing protection from salt spray exposure for 2,000h.

Rapid coupling is reported to be ensured by a triple-start thread and a single-turn coupling nut, while the use of recessed pins, a rigid dielectric insert and a 100 per cent scoop-proof design minimises potential contact damage. The connectors have a minimum durability of 1,500 couplings.

The CTV series connectors are available in an enormous range of shell styles,shell sizes, insert arrangements and contact types, and since PEI- Genesis holds its stock at piece-part level, it is able to assemble any variant that may be required.
